Marketing & Partnership Manager
Thames Valley Park, Reading
Contract is for 18 months

Brook Street is currently working on behalf of our Global IT Client to recruit a Global Ops Team Member Marketing & Partnerships Manager. This is a contract role based in Reading for 18 months.

As a Brook Street contractor you will be entitled to 25 days holiday per annum, 8 days paid Bank Holidays pro rota, discounted gym membership, use of the onsite health facility, access to online learning and training, free parking and an excellent subsidised restaurant.

Salary: Up to £36,300 per annum, based on experience, plus benefits

Job Description
The Global Ops Team, in Gaming, has the objective of supporting key gaming business priorities within our entire gaming ecosystem, across hardware, products, games and subscription services. Objectives include market share, revenue, profitability goals across Platform and 1st Party Gaming titles. The Global Optimisation Team Marketing Manager's role will be to actively lead several 1st Party Titles Campaigns Go-To-Market Plans, leading day-to-day planning and marketing execution tasks related to the gaming Marketing Communications Team and to support executing Brand Partnership activations across the EMEA region, covering multiple markets across multiple categories.

This will involve helping to provide Marcom Strategy clarity and at the same time, being the voice of priority Global markets back into our Central WDG Marketing Team based in the US.
